# When your AI-assisted world outgrows its transcripts

One of the stranger problems in long-running AI-assisted worldbuilding is that the world can grow faster than the system used to remember it.

At first, continuity may be simple:

- a few character sheets;

- some pasted transcripts;

- native platform memory;

- a lore document;

- and a prompt reminding the model who everyone is.

Then the setting starts living.

Characters change.

Relationships accumulate history.

Factions split.

Locations acquire emotional meaning.

A joke from six months ago becomes the foundation of a religion.

Two contradictory accounts both need to remain canon because they belong to different witnesses.

Eventually, the archive becomes too large to paste forward, but too meaningful to flatten into a short summary.

That is the problem we have been working on inside VESTIGIA.

VESTIGIA is a long-running collaborative world, continuity archive, research environment, and inhabited fiction involving humans, AI-originated identities, relationships, campaigns, rituals, art, technical systems, and a frankly unreasonable number of labeled folders.

Our archive is not organized as one giant transcript.

Instead, we use several kinds of continuity structure for different purposes.

## Identity anchors

A character or resident needs more than a biography.

Useful identity anchors preserve things like:

- voice;

- values;

- recurring tensions;

- relationship orientation;

- symbols;

- boundaries;

- self-understanding;

- and the ways they tend to interpret events.

We call some of these compressed identity anchors **breathprints**.

They are not meant to reproduce an entire person from a magic paragraph.

They provide a recognizable starting shape that can be accepted, revised, or rejected by the identity returning through it.

## Memory blooms

A transcript records what happened.

A memory bloom records what mattered.

A useful bloom may preserve:

- important events;

- emotional transitions;

- unresolved questions;

- changes in relationships;

- decisions and their reasons;

- contradictions that should remain open;

- and cues that help future sessions recover the meaning of prior scenes.

This creates a much better re-entry point than dumping thousands of raw messages into context.

## Layered canon

Not every generated idea should immediately become permanent lore.

We distinguish between:

- scratch material;

- experiments;

- candidate lore;

- reviewed additions;

- alternate timelines;

- discarded material;

- and established canon.

That lets the world remain playful without allowing every improvisation to silently rewrite the setting.

## Provenance

We try to preserve not only a claim, but where it came from.

Was it:

- directly witnessed;

- stated by a character;

- reported by someone else;

- inferred by the house;

- proposed but not accepted;

- or formally incorporated into canon?

That distinction becomes especially important when multiple characters remember the same event differently.

Contradiction is not always a continuity failure.

Sometimes contradiction is the world.

## Relationship continuity

Characters are not static entries in a wiki.

A good archive should remember:

- who met whom;

- what they initially believed about each other;

- how trust changed;

- what promises were made;

- what injuries remain;

- what names or symbols became shared;

- and who each person became during the relationship.

This is especially useful for long-running AI characters, because factual memory alone often preserves the nouns while losing the emotional grammar connecting them.

## Scoped retrieval

The answer to a large archive is not always a larger context dump.

Often it is better to retrieve only:

- the relevant character anchors;

- the current location;

- the active relationship history;

- the unresolved plot threads;

- and a compact recent-session handoff.

One room before the whole city.

One relationship before the entire family tree.

One active mystery before the complete mythology.

## Continuity handoffs

At the end of an important session, we often preserve a small handoff containing:

- what happened;

- what changed;

- what remains unresolved;

- what should be remembered next time;

- and what should not yet be promoted into canon.

This dramatically reduces the amount of reconstruction required when returning after a break.

## Why this matters for worldbuilding

The deeper question is not merely:

> How do we make the model remember more?

It is:

> What kind of memory allows a world to keep becoming itself?

A useful continuity system should preserve change without flattening identity.

It should allow characters to surprise us without becoming arbitrary.

It should remember old relationships without trapping anyone permanently inside their earliest portrayal.

It should make room for unreliable narrators, disputed history, evolving cultures, and lore that changes meaning as the world grows.

The Singing Ferryman:

Spoken about in legend as ferrying the souls of drowning sailors on to the Final Sea with Laughter, Merriment and Music played on his Accordion. He takes payment in rum, thus leading to many a sailor always carrying a small hipflask charm with a shot of Rum in it so their souls are not lost at sea forever.

The legends say that the Ferryman does his utmost to ferry the souls of the sailors onwards in the Great Circuit of creation with a hurrah and night of merry making.
He is considered one of the benevolent aspects of Mortis the God of Death.

A route with two answers

What if the journey from one stable place to another did not have the same operational interval as the reverse journey?

ETC-012 begins with that premise:

I(A → B) ≠ I(B → A)

I is an operational interval: the quantity governing translation or propagation between ordered places inside the model. It is not a claim about an ordinary road on Earth, and it does not decide whether the underlying reality is best understood as directed geometry or as reciprocal support geometry plus a universal directional transport coupling. Both readings remain live in ETC-012.

Inside the model, the asymmetry is intrinsic to the ordered interval relation under the declared carrier scope. It is not ordinary traffic congestion, terrain, a one-way-road policy, or a resistance affecting only one selected carrier.

The Horizon Study asks a different question:

What must a civilization become when every relation of access has an outbound interval, an inbound interval, and a separate burden of recurrence?

Its central thesis is:

When nearness has a direction, reciprocity ceases to be an assumed property of geography and becomes a deliberate achievement of civilization.

Three maps, not one

A reciprocal civilization can often speak as though two places are simply “ten units apart.” A directional civilization needs at least three maps.

The outbound map

The outbound map asks:

What can this place reach?

Where can its people, commands, care,

supplies, information, or force arrive quickly?

It records ordered intervals of the form:

I(P → Q)

The inbound map

The inbound map asks:

What can reach this place?

Whose petitions, warnings, workers,

witnesses, goods, or threats arrive quickly?

It records the reverse family of ordered intervals:

I(Q → P)

The recurrence map

The recurrence map asks a different question:

Which relations can sustain a complete

request and response, commute, rescue sortie,

inspection, vehicle cycle, or return?

Under ETC-012’s selected cycle-neutral closure, a completed same-carrier pair satisfies:

I(P → Q) + I(Q → P) = 2σ(P,Q)

This is a qualified result. It depends on the selected closure and on comparing the same carrier across the paired route. It does not establish a globally realized potential field, and it does not make the one-way asymmetry unreal.

In the study’s bounded illustrative Ridge–Basin example, the route may be labeled:

A → B: 8

B → A: 32

Completed pair: 40

The favorable first leg matters. The completed physical recurrence matters too. One symmetric number cannot replace both lived journeys and the full cycle.

Who owns the difficult return?

An open journey may end at its destination. Migration, evacuation, deployment, delivery, exile, or one-way settlement can preserve the directional advantage because the original traveler or carrier does not complete a return.

A recurrent system must eventually pay for the whole operation. Vehicles must recover. Responders must be relieved. Workers must come home or become residents. Appeals must return to the deciding institution. A state must receive the consequences of the orders it sends.

Institutions complicate this because they rarely send one identical carrier around one simple loop. A market can send slow freight outward and fast payment information back. A city can receive a worker while wages return electronically. A court can send an order rapidly while the affected person must travel physically in the difficult direction. A ceasefire can return as a signal while troops, wounded people, equipment, and prisoners remain.

The institutional ledger can close while the human or material cycle remains open.

That produces the study’s recurring diagnostic:

What did the institution count as complete—and who inherited the unfinished return?

The easy leg creates opportunity. Power appears when one institution can declare completion while another person, locality, vehicle, family, or future generation remains responsible for everything left on the far side.

The projective and absorptive state

Let C be a capital and P a province.

A projective capital reaches the province faster than the province reaches it. Commands, deployment, policy, and official narratives move outward quickly. Reports, petitions, appeals, election results, and evidence return slowly.

Its characteristic danger is:

It can act before it can know.

An absorptive capital is reached by the province faster than it reaches the province. Requests, warnings, and petitions arrive quickly. Services, relief, enforcement, and public acknowledgment travel outward slowly.

Its characteristic danger is:

It can know before it can act.

Neither arrangement is morally predetermined. Directional timing creates pressure, not political destiny. A projective state can use rapid outward reach for care while refusing to enforce before replies arrive. An absorptive state can use rapid inbound access for participation while delegating practical action locally.

The deeper solution is often not to move the capital. It is to remove unnecessary journeys to it.

A procedure has local closure when it can become valid and operative within its proper scope without waiting for fresh permission from a universal remote center. Local closure requires pre-existing competence, bounded scope, usable resources, durable evidence, and an external path for review. It is not local infallibility. It is a way to prevent every birth record, emergency, filing, or ordinary decision from making the full trip to one hidden capital and back.

The public without one present

Directional information creates a plural present.

Imagine that Basin records a rupture at source time zero. Ridge issues a later bulletin at time four. Because the routes differ, Middle receives the later Ridge bulletin at time eight and the earlier Basin record at time sixteen.

Middle receives the later event first.

No one has to falsify a record for the chronology to appear reversed at the receiving node. Arrival order is a fact about the route, not necessarily a fact about history.

Different places can therefore possess different truthful states at the same nominal moment:

Basin truthfully knows:

The rupture occurred.

Ridge truthfully knows:

No Basin report has reached Ridge.

Middle truthfully knows:

The Ridge bulletin arrived first.

The error begins when a local knowledge statement is enlarged into a universal claim:

No report has reached Ridge.

becomes:

Nothing happened.

A truthful archive or public institution must publish its source, node, time, effective scope, completeness frontier, current standing, and unresolved qualifications.

Canonical does not have to mean that every node holds an identical sentence at every instant. It can mean that every difference has provenance, standing, scope, and an authorized path toward resolution.

The fact that a conflict remains unresolved can itself be canonical.

Freedom requires practical reversal

Directional civilization separates legal permission from practical capacity.

A worker may be free to resign while lacking independent housing, documents, transport, or a return reserve. A refugee may reach a sanctuary whose route protects against rapid removal but also makes voluntary departure difficult. A defendant may possess a formal right of appeal while irreversible enforcement can occur before the earliest valid stay could return. A prison sentence may expire while the released person remains geographically stranded without documents, care, or a viable destination.

The geometry does not recognize the categories “worker,” “refugee,” “innocent,” “guilty,” or “deserving.” The same ordered route applies under the same carrier conditions. Institutions must determine standing through evidence and process rather than pretending the route has already judged the person.

This yields a broad ethical distinction:

PHYSICAL REVERSIBILITY

PRACTICAL REVERSIBILITY

A legal right to leave, return, cancel, appeal, reverse, or be released is incomplete without enough time, real carrier capacity or a local alternative, independent access to the route, usable documents and resources, and a viable next state.

No institution should convert another person’s unavoidable delay into consent, guilt, waiver, absence, noncompliance, or continued authority.

The arrival fallacy

Directional systems are especially vulnerable to the arrival fallacy: treating the first successful leg as completion of the whole obligation.

A payment can credit the seller while the vehicle, waste, worker, and warranty burden remain elsewhere. A rescue team can reach a disaster while patient care, responder relief, apparatus recovery, and the sending community’s reserve remain open. A court can issue a judgment while appeal, remedy, public correction, and restoration remain unfinished. A prison can open the gate while transport, housing, medicine, identity, and civil standing remain unresolved.

The study therefore uses multiple-closure accounting. A process may have separate informational, legal, financial, physical, recurrent, social, ecological, and archival closures.

A declaration that something is “complete” should identify which closure has occurred and which obligations remain open.

The point is not to make completion impossible. It is to stop one ledger from erasing every other ledger.

Force and the unfinished return

Directional force can be strongest at the beginning of commitment.

An army can advance rapidly, reinforce quickly, and send commands along the easy leg. Reports, casualty recovery, withdrawal, equipment return, prisoner transition, and demobilization may lie along the difficult leg. Rapid command is not the same as rapid control. Advance is an open-path achievement; military power is a completed-cycle capacity.

The same distinction matters at peace.

A ceasefire signal can reach the theater and return confirmation long before troops physically leave. During that residual-presence interval, the force may still need narrow authority to protect people, secure weapons, provide medical care, and complete withdrawal. Physical presence does not automatically preserve authority to govern civilian life.

A just peace therefore requires powers to expire faster than responsibilities.

The power to fight, occupy, censor,

requisition, or detain narrows or ends.

The duty to withdraw, release, repair,

clear weapons, preserve evidence,

and support displaced people continues.

Unfinished logistics create duties. They do not create a new constitution.

Reciprocity as infrastructure

The study converges on a set of institutional and ethical principles. These are not additions to ETC-012 mechanics.

Local closure

Let valid acts end within their proper scope instead of requiring every ordinary action to visit one remote center.

Reply-horizon protection

Do not call delay silence, consent, waiver, default, or disobedience before a practical answer could be received, prepared, filed, and transmitted.

Review before irreversible harm

Act quickly to preserve options and slowly to destroy them. A valid correction must have a protected opportunity to prevent irreversible consequence.

Practical reversal

A formal right is incomplete without time, capacity, independence, documents, resources, and a viable destination.

Plural-present honesty

Publish where knowledge came from, when it was current, what scope it governs, how complete the source frontier is, and what remains contested or unavailable.

Multiple-closure accounting

Name which parts of a transaction, rescue, judgment, release, withdrawal, or peace have closed and which remain open.

No residual authority

Unfinished logistics, stale records, medical need, transport backlog, or physical presence do not automatically extend authority whose declared scope has ended.

Full-cycle responsibility

Disclose who bears the difficult return: workers, vehicles, patients, families, defendants, prisoners, responders, soldiers, localities, or future generations.

What the study does not claim

The Two-Sided Map does not claim that:

real geography or real institutions operate according to ETC-012;

geometry recognizes truth, innocence, citizenship, intention, rank, or moral worth;

a favorable route creates entitlement or legitimacy;

cycle neutrality makes open-path asymmetry unreal;

heterogeneous institutional processes create free energy or perpetual arbitrage;

the selected Φ closure is globally or continuously realized;

endpoint intervals establish continuous pursuit or interception along an unspecified path;

directed geometry is the uniquely established ontology;

an institution can alter the ETC-012 interval by law or policy;

this Horizon Study modifies or stabilizes ETC-012;

This Horizon Study does not modify or stabilize ETC-012. The source configuration remains at S2, Published — Provisional, and unstabilized, and its five stabilization blockers remain open.

Closing thesis

A directional civilization does not become just by pretending its routes are equal.

It becomes more reciprocal by refusing to let unequal routes silently decide standing, consent, guilt, freedom, citizenship, or authority.

Every institution becomes legible by asking what it counts as complete—and who remains on the far side after completion is declared.

One of my side hobbies is world building, I love thinking of ideas for made up worlds, its lore, why it exists, creating people who live there, etc. I also love RPG games, DnD campaigns, etc. Anyone who's built out a world past the overall stage knows the wall you hit: you've got the geography, the factions, the tone locked in, and then you need forty named NPCs, a bestiary that doesn't feel generic, items that actually sound like they belong in your world.

That grind is fun sometimes, but sometimes I want to have help with it as well, and just explore what's possible. I also wanted something that holds every bit of info of my world in one place.

So I built something to handle it.

Main Wiki Page

Chronicled takes a world you describe once — genre, tone, factions, whatever you've already got — and generates NPCs, enemies, items, faction lore, and portraits that actually sound like they belong to that world specifically. If your world calls its currency "scrip" and its soldiers "line-walkers," that's what shows up in what it generates, not "gold pieces" and "guards."

Generated Enemy Entry
Enemy Stats, Lore, Abilities

Mechanically, it's a short wizard up front: you set your world's identity, tone, and factions, and even define your own stat system if you want something other than a generic D&D-style spread. Then you generate content piece by piece from there. Everything gets auto-filed into a browsable wiki as you go, and new generations stay consistent with what already exists (referencing real factions, real characters, matching the vocabulary you've already established). Underneath is mainly AI API calls with Gemini and Nano Banana for generating content! What started as something personal and niche, turned into a much larger project to be generalized for user use.

This is a noncommercial, fan-made worldbuilding experiment inspired by the color philosophy of Magic: The Gathering. It is not an official Wizards of the Coast product. I drew the central diagram by hand without using a protractor and assembled the cards in Magic Set Editor using its “Modern Extra—Modern with Extra Colors” format. ChatGPT helped me test and refine the relationships between the colors and helped edit portions of the accompanying poem, while I made the final creative decisions, revisions, and presentation.

I call the system the Concordance Web. It imagines a version of Magic built around ten colors rather than five: Light, Architecture, Water and Air, Aether, Darkness, Flux, Fire, Energy, Earth, and Love. Colorless is represented separately by the Void.

The thick blue lines around the Web represent elemental alliances, while the thin pink lines crossing its interior represent conflicts. Each color allies with the four colors closest to it and opposes the five colors farther away. Together, the allied connections form a protective ring around the perimeter.

At the center lies the Void: an absence of color, identity, substance, and meaning. It is stronger than any single color, but weaker than all ten colors acting together. When you focus toward the center, the Web appears dominated by conflict. When you look around its edge, the alliances form an unbroken ring that contains the Void.

Five pairs occupy directly opposite points of the decagon. These are the most absolute oppositions in the system, because they share no mutual allied bridge. Their connecting lines therefore pass directly through the Void, representing a confrontation so fundamental that neither side can reach the other through cooperation or common ground.

The twelve-part poem explores all forty-five unique relationships between the ten colors. Standard text represents allied pairs, italicized text represents opposing pairs, and bold italicized lines represent the five absolute oppositions that pass through the Void. The final sections describe the colors uniting against the Void and the arrival of heroes from colliding universes.

The Rescuer People and the River Runners

The Rescuer People live in a volcanic polar region shaped by glaciers, snowfields, hot springs, and warm mountain lakes. Their settlements consist of low, rounded buildings made from dark basalt, slate, ceramics, and other volcanic materials. Hot spring water flows through open channels and underground systems, heating streets, homes, workshops, and dairies. Steam rises above reddish-brown ceramic roofs, and even in deep winter some streets remain free of snow.

Their entire way of life is built around the controlled use and sharing of warmth. Geothermal energy is used for heating, cooking, drying, smoking food, and processing milk. Heat and food are not regarded as private possessions, but as resources that must support the whole community.

The River Runners

The River Runners are semi-aquatic animals combining features of reindeer and sturgeon. They have strong legs for walking and wading, a plated body, a powerful swimming tail, and eyes and nostrils positioned high on the head. This allows them to keep most of the head underwater while feeding and still breathe and watch their surroundings.

The sexes differ strongly in size and body shape.

Females weigh around 100–200 kilograms, depending on the season and their fat reserves. They are slimmer, more economical, and have longer, more enduring legs. They never grow antlers.

Males usually weigh 250–350 kilograms, with exceptionally large individuals reaching about 400 kilograms. They have heavier shoulders, shorter and more muscular legs, and grow a large antler crown during summer.

The Female Life Cycle

During summer, females and their young live along the coast. Warm, mineral-rich water flowing down from the volcanic lakes encourages the growth of vast seagrass meadows. The females feed intensively and build up large fat reserves for the difficult autumn migration and the coming winter.

In late autumn, pregnant females begin the demanding journey upstream toward the warm volcanic lakes. The males remain at the coast throughout the year.

The lakes are heated by geothermal springs and remain around 20–30°C during winter. Soon after arriving, the females give birth to live calves. The young are nursed with exceptionally rich, fatty milk. Because the water is warm, the calves use little energy to maintain their body temperature and can invest most of the milk’s energy in rapid growth, muscle development, and building their first fat reserves.

When spring snowmelt begins, large amounts of cold water enter the lake. The lake slowly cools, while the water level and strength of the outflowing rivers increase. Once the temperature and water level reach a certain threshold, the females and calves begin their descent toward the sea.

The journey downstream requires relatively little energy because the current carries them for much of the way. For the calves, however, it is their first transition from warm lake water into colder rivers and coastal waters.

At the same time, warm and mineral-rich water from the volcanic lake is carried toward the coast. Together with the longer summer days, it stimulates the growth of the seagrass meadows. The animals therefore arrive at the sea just as the coastal food supply begins to peak.

The Male Life Cycle

The males remain in the coastal region all year.

During winter they carry no antlers and are much less aggressive. Territories are only loosely defended, and several males may tolerate each other in the same area. When attacked by the large beluga-like predators, they flee into shallow water or onto land and rely on short, powerful sprints to escape.

As the days grow longer and the coastal water becomes warmer, their hormone levels change. Antlers regrow, their neck and shoulder muscles become heavier, and their behaviour becomes increasingly territorial.

The strongest males claim the richest seagrass grounds. These territories are valuable because they attract the best-fed females. A male’s reproductive success therefore depends not only on his size and antlers, but on his ability to control a productive feeding area.

After mating season, hormone levels fall again. The females leave for the mountains, the males shed their antlers, and winter behaviour becomes calmer and less territorial.

Semi-Domestication by the Rescuer People

The River Runners remain wild and free, but the Rescuer People have developed a long-standing semi-domesticated relationship with the females that return to the volcanic lakes.

During the short summer, the people cut and dry large quantities of hay and suitable aquatic plants. These stores are kept in dry, geothermally warmed stone halls.

When the females arrive in autumn, they are fed at established places along the lakeshore. This reduces their winter weight loss, improves their condition, and allows them to produce more milk for their calves.

The animals are not enclosed and do not belong to individuals. Many females, however, return to the same feeding places year after year and become accustomed to particular caretakers. The people take only part of the additional milk produced because of the winter feeding.

The Return Season

The first arriving females mark the beginning of a festival and working season lasting several weeks.

From that moment onward:

feeding places are opened,

hay stores are brought out,

paths to the lake are cleared,

geothermal dairies are prepared,

and scouts continue watching for later groups.

The mood is both joyful and serious. The return of the females means that the natural cycle continues and that the community may be able to secure food for the following year.

The females are first allowed to rest, feed, and give birth. Milking begins only once the calves are healthy and drinking regularly.

A traditional principle guides the process:

> First the calf, then the people.

The First Fresh Cheese

The first substantial milk of the season is used to make one enormous fresh cheese.

This cheese has a religious and communal meaning. It represents:

the safe return of the herds,

the birth of the new calves,

the survival of the people,

and the continued bond between the volcano, the animals, and the community.

It is made large enough for every member of the settlement to receive a portion. No one is excluded, even if the share is small.

The cheese is eaten during the main ceremony of the Return Season. Unlike the other cheeses, it is not stored. It belongs entirely to the present year and is consumed by the whole community.

Hard and Smoked Cheese

Most later milk is processed into hard cheese and smoked cheese.

The dairies are built into freestanding stone buildings close to the hot springs. Geothermal water and steam flow through channels beneath the floors and inside the walls.

Different rooms are kept at different temperatures:

warm rooms for gently heating milk,

draining rooms for curds,

pressing rooms with heavy stone weights,

smoking rooms,

and stable maturation chambers.

The cheese is aged for approximately one full year. This means that the people mainly eat cheese made during the previous winter while the new cheese matures for the next one.

Their food security therefore depends on continuity. Each generation lives partly from the care and labour of the year before.

Cultural Meaning

For the Rescuer People, the River Runners are not ordinary livestock. They are wild migration partners, winter providers, and living symbols of the relationship between warmth, survival, and community.

The volcano warms the lake.

The lake protects the calves.

The people feed the mothers.

The mothers provide milk.

The milk becomes food for the following winter.

The entire system reflects the central belief of the Rescuer People:

> Warmth is not owned. It is passed on.
